Autophagic Degradation of Gasdermin D Protects against Nucleus Pulposus Cell Pyroptosis and Retards Intervertebral Disc Degeneration In Vivo

Figure 1

Histological staining results of human and rat intervertebral discs. (a) HE staining showed the morphology of rat discs and human NP tissues (upper panel), and histological grades were calculated based on HE staining (lower panel). (b) Immunofluorescence analysis of ATG5 (red) and type collagen II (green) in rat and human NP tissues. Corresponding fluorescence intensity analysis is listed in the right panel. Scale bar, 50 μm. (c) Immunofluorescence analysis of GSDMD-N (red) and type collagen II (green) in rat and human NP tissues (left panel) and fluorescence intensity results (right panel). Overlap coefficient based on immunofluorescence results showed the colocalization relationship of (d) ATG5 and COL2A1 or (e) GSDMD-N and COL2A1. (f) Western blot analysis of ATG5, LC3, GSDMD-N, COL2A1, and MMP3 in human nondegenerative and degenerative NP tissues and (g) corresponding quantification of protein levels.
